ما هي وحدة Win32Con في بيثون؟ اين ممكن ان اجده؟

StackOverflow https://stackoverflow.com/questions/227928

  •  03-07-2019
  •  | 
  •  

سؤال

أقوم بإنشاء مشروع مفتوح المصدر يستخدم Python و C ++ في Windows. وصلت إلى رسالة الخطأ التالية:

 ImportError: No module named win32con 

حدث الشيء نفسه في رمز "مُلائم" الذي يعمل (باستثناء جهاز الكمبيوتر الخاص بي: P)

أعتقد أن هذا نوع من الوحدة النمطية "الشائعة" في بيثون لأنني رأيت عدة رسائل في منتديات أخرى ولكن لا شيء يمكن أن يساعدني.

لدي Python2.6 ، هل يجب أن يكون هذه الوحدة مثبتة بالفعل؟ هل هذا شيء من VC ++؟

شكرا للمساعدة.

حصلت على عنوان URL هذا http://sourceforge.net/projects/pywin32/ لكنني لست متأكدًا مما يجب فعله مع القابل للتنفيذ: S

هل كانت مفيدة؟

المحلول

تحتوي هذه الوحدة على ثوابت تتعلق ببرمجة Win32. إنه ليس جزءًا من إصدار Python 2.6 ، ولكن يجب أن يكون جزءًا من تنزيل مشروع Pywin32.

يحرر: أتصور أن القابل للتنفيذ هو برنامج تثبيت ، على الرغم من أن آخر مرة قمت فيها بتنزيل Pywin32 ، فقد كان مجرد ملف مضغوط.

نصائح أخرى

pip install pypiwin32

الرسوم الرمزية كان معبأة معبأة حتى يرسل شخص ما التصحيح لإنشاء عجلات كجزء من pywin32 بناء العملية للإغلاق https://sourceforge.net/p/pywin32/bugs/680/

حسنًا ، لقد تعثرت هنا مرتين للتركيبات على جهازين ، لذا إليك رابط سريع لهذا Ressource

http://sourceforge.net/projects/pywin32/files/pywin32/

هذه هي صفحة التنزيل الفعلية للمشروع والآن تنزيل readme

نلاحظ أن تنزيل Pywin32 تحتوي الصفحة على مثبتات للإصدار 2.6 (I386 و AMD64). ال activestate التوزيع هو مثبت واحد يتضمن pywin32 - حاليا في الإصدار 2.5.2.

تم العثور على مراجع تنزيل PYWIN32 بما في ذلك مراجع المشروع في Pypi السجل.

انتقل إلى: C: Python27 lib site-packages win32 lib ونسخ ملف win32con.py إلى دليل المشروع الخاص بك.

مرخصة بموجب: CC-BY-SA مع الإسناد
لا تنتمي إلى StackOverflow
scroll top